JPG even at high res tends to get 'artifacts' around text, it's more a photo format. Best solution I found was to save as PNG (Lossless format) then run through "Tiny PNG" website for a pre-minified PNG and then upload those. Ultimately I think Amazon outputs everything as JPG that you upload so there might not be a solution. Also, make sure you are working with a source image that does not have this issue, i.e. a TIFF or similar and save to PNG directly. As if the problem is with the source image, this will never get resolved no matter what format you use etc.
